Dec, 2025 : Global Server Market Surges 61% in Q3 2025 on AI Demand
📅 - The global server market delivered one of its strongest quarters on record in the third quarter of 2025, underscoring how AI workloads and cloud-scale deployments are reshaping enterprise infrastructure investment. New figures from IDC's Worldwide Quarterly Server Tracker show total worldwide server revenue reached $112.4 billion during the quarter, marking a year-over-year increase of 61 percent compared with the same period in 2024.
The surge reflects a market increasingly driven by accelerated computing, stated IDC. 📅 - SASE Drives 25% Access Router Market Drop in Q3 2025 - The global enterprise networking market is undergoing a structural shift as Secure Access Service Edge continues to displace traditional access routers at an accelerating pace. New data from Dell'Oro Group shows that the SASE market expanded 21 percent year over year in the third quarter of 2025, reaching nearly $3 billion in revenue, while spending on legacy access routers fell sharply by 25 percent during the same period.
The contrasting trajectories illustrate how enterprises are rapidly reallocating budgets away from hardware-centric connectivity toward cloud-delivered networking and security platforms.

📅 - Pure Data Centres to Develop €1B+ Hyperscale Campus in Amsterdam - Pure Data Centres has secured what it describes as Europe's largest standalone hyperscale data center lease signed in 2025, marking a significant infrastructure commitment in one of the continent's most capacity-constrained digital markets. The agreement covers an entire 78-megawatt hyperscale campus in Westpoort, Amsterdam, with Pure DC committing more than €1 billion to develop the site for a single hyperscale customer.
